Transaction c9100ca1b32052179a8415d39974bfc563172459a36ce278c847ca730e6e050a
1 Input
1 Outputs
- c9100ca1b32052179a8415d39974bfc563172459a36ce278c847ca730e6e050a:0
value 27039697
address 3PJSgmqAT3V6NfxpQJpkXtq3kUtFkdV7xU